Although electronically signed patent assignments are acceptable for U.S.-filed patent applications, it is recommended to obtain wet signatures from all parties for patent assignments if there is a chance of filing the patent application internationally.
Requirements for filing a provisional application: A detailed written description of the invention including drawings. Title of the invention. Name(s) of all inventors. Inventor(s) residence(s) Name and registration number of attorney or agent and docket number (if applicable) Correspondence address.

Pay online (preferred method) - Pay immediately in the Patent Maintenance Fees Storefront with a credit or debit card, USPTO deposit account, or EFT. Do not submit the payment via EFS-Web. Pay by wire - See the instructions for sending a wire payment to the USPTO.
You can file a patent application on behalf of yourself or your co-inventors. Alternatively, you can hire a registered patent agent or attorney to file your application for you.
